About the job:

The AssistantProperty Manager is responsible for assisting with the daily operation of the entire property/properties. Perform all administrative duties for both internal and external agencies and maintain positive relationships with the residents of the property.

Essentials: 

  • Assist in managing all aspects of building's occupancy and maintenance.
  • Responsible for processing background checks, rental applications, certifications, rent calculations and prepare leasing documents in accordance with the regulatory agency’s specification and Fair Housing Laws.
  • Coordinate with tenants, maintenance team and third party vendors to address maintenance issues. Includes producing work orders and entering the completion of work orders.
  • Rent collection and posting. Record all rents, assist with payables.
  • Assist with quarterly unit inspections and assign needed repairs.
  • Assist in preparing property and files for all state and internal audits.
  • Maintain resident and property files and waiting lists.
  • Prepare all notices to residents.
  • Represent the company in a positive, professional manner to all callers, guests and staff.
  • Order office supplies.
  • Contributes to team efforts by accomplishing related tasks as needed.
